Vilkas purity quest bugged
So vilkas' purity quest is super bugged and ive tried using the console command "setstage cr13 10" to try to start it over like it said in the wiki but since the quest is in the completed section with the first objective not bubbled in it doesnt seem to work I also cant get any followers as the game still thinks i have vilkas following me nor can i get anymore quests from any of the companions leaders. Ive also tried just using setstage cr13 20 and 100 to complete the quest but no dice. anyone have a fix?
Also i completed a few quests after it was moved to completed so i dont know if that affects anything.

A little late to answer your question, but; Have you tried to wait a couple of days in game and done some quests? And then try to speak with Vilkas? I have had the same problem for a few days and I almost wanted to tear my hair out. My only option was to revert to a previous save, something that I didn't want to do. Anyway, after a few days in game and IRL I went to see if Vilkas wanted something. He had a job offer for me, even though I hadn't really completed his "Purity" quest. I took the job and completed it. After that I went to see if Farkas had a job for me. I knew that he also had a Purity quest. He offered me a separate quest to go clean out Falmer presence in a cave near Riften (He may offer a different quest to you). Farkas' next quest was the Purity quest. I took the offer inside Jorrvaskr and he followed me out. To my suprise he didn't go back in as Vilkas did. When I hovered over the quest marker for Ysgramor's Tomb, it said Clear Farkas for lycanthropy or whatever AND it also said Clear Vilkas for Lycanthropy. I fast-traveled there with Farkas as my follower and defeated his Ghost in the tomb and completed the quest. In my Journal the Purity quest said completed with all tasks.

After all this I was able to have a new follower and dismiss them successfully. I also had a Misc. quest to ask the Companions for work. This is where I am as I am writing this answer. To you it may not be as useful since it it was last year, but to anyone who encounter the same issue: Good luck and hopefully it will clear the problem that is this awful glitch.

The issue I have discovered (this information is for anyone else dealing with the issue) is that the game see's Vilkas (or Farkas, whoever you did first) as still on the quest. In other words: What people are doing is starting one Purity quest and leaving them at the tomb then trying to instantly start the next Purity quest. This does not work because as long as they remain at the tomb to *reflect* or what have you, they are still considered on the quest and with you. The reason for this was based on your own character being cured and having back up if you did. You must wait at least 24 hours or longer, for them to return back to Whiterun. This is why many suggest taking an off quest from Aela in the mean time. The purity quest is not officially over (or them leaving your side) until they return to Whiterun. Meaning that the reason the 2nd brother *glitches* is because the 1st is still on their own Purity quest according to the game (stops following you etc etc). Do not even try talking to the other brother until you see them return. Always check the city, in any way you can and make sure 1st brother has returned and has *reset* or going about his normal daily routine. Keep doing random quests until he does. And *then* start the 2nd Purity quest. And you will have no issues whatsoever.
